- Description
- Polyclonal Antibody against Human HAPLN1, Gene description: hyaluronan and proteoglycan link protein 1, Alternative Gene Names: CRTL1, Validated applications: IHC, Uniprot ID: P10915, Storage: Store at +4°C for short term storage. Long time storage is recommended at -20°C.
